    I was in New York to attend an event very near the Herald Square Hotel. I booked a room, not expecting much for the very reasonable price. It's a small place, with a lovely entrance and tiny lobby. My room was nearly perfect. It was small, but had fourteen foot ceilings with elaborate molding, a big brass bed and a (black!) chandelier. The large bath was faced in marble and also featured a small chandelier. Good water pressure, nice towels and sufficient lighting too. The bed was comfortable, with plenty of pillows and, best of all, no bleachy-off-gassing from the bedding. I really hate waking up with sore, red eyes from industrial laundry processing. I was on the second floor, but the room was quiet. The old walls masked any sound from other rooms and I didn't hear street noise either. The hotel is undergoing renovations, and although my room looked recently redone, I would have appreciated an outlet near the head of the bed. I did not avail myself of the advertised continental breakfast. There's no way I'm going to Manhattan and missing out on trying one of thousands of great places to eat! I would certainly stay at the Herald Square Hotel again. It had everything I wanted - a clean, pretty, comfortable, well-appointed room. The neighborhood is full of good Korean restaurants, and handy to lots of midtown attractions.There are parking garages nearby.
